探索C# 7.0的核心特性与实践应用
1. C# 7.0简介
C# 是一种通用的、类型安全的、面向对象的编程语言。它旨在提高程序员的工作效率,通过平衡简单性、表达力和性能,使开发人员能够更高效地编写高质量的代码。C# 语言是平台无关的,但它与微软的.NET Framework紧密结合,特别是在C# 7.0中,它针对.NET Framework 4.6/4.7进行了优化。
2. 编译与运行环境
C# 源代码文件通常以 .cs
扩展名保存。编译C#程序的两种常见方法是使用集成开发环境(IDE)如Visual Studio,或通过命令行手动调用C#编译器 csc.exe
。以下是通过命令行编译C#程序的具体步骤:
- 保存代码文件 :将C#代码保存为一个文件,例如
MyFirstProgram.cs
。 - 打开命令行 :导航到保存文件的目录。
- 调用编译器 :输入命令
csc MyFirstProgram.cs
。编译器位于%ProgramFiles(X86)%\msbuild\14.0\bin
目录下。 - 生成可执行文件 &